Aspirin and Dabigatran Drug Interaction

Summary

The combination of aspirin and dabigatran significantly increases the risk of bleeding complications due to their additive anticoagulant and antiplatelet effects. This interaction requires careful monitoring and consideration of the benefit-risk ratio in each patient.

Introduction

Aspirin is a widely used nonsteroidal anti-inflammatory drug (NSAID) that irreversibly inhibits cyclooxygenase enzymes, providing antiplatelet, anti-inflammatory, and analgesic effects. It is commonly prescribed for cardiovascular protection, pain relief, and fever reduction. Dabigatran (Pradaxa) is a direct oral anticoagulant (DOAC) that specifically inhibits thrombin (Factor IIa), used primarily for stroke prevention in atrial fibrillation and treatment of venous thromboembolism. Both medications affect the coagulation system through different mechanisms.

Mechanism of Interaction

The interaction between aspirin and dabigatran occurs through complementary effects on hemostasis. Aspirin irreversibly acetylates cyclooxygenase-1 (COX-1) in platelets, preventing thromboxane A2 synthesis and reducing platelet aggregation for the platelet's lifespan (7-10 days). Dabigatran directly and reversibly binds to thrombin's active site, preventing fibrinogen conversion to fibrin and inhibiting thrombin-induced platelet activation. When used together, these medications create additive anticoagulant effects - aspirin impairs primary hemostasis (platelet plug formation) while dabigatran impairs secondary hemostasis (fibrin clot formation), significantly increasing bleeding risk.

Risks and Symptoms

The primary clinical risk of combining aspirin and dabigatran is a substantially increased risk of bleeding complications, including major bleeding events such as gastrointestinal hemorrhage, intracranial bleeding, and other life-threatening bleeds. Studies have shown that concomitant use can increase bleeding risk by 60-100% compared to dabigatran alone. Patients at particular risk include those over 75 years old, those with renal impairment, history of bleeding disorders, peptic ulcer disease, or concurrent use of other anticoagulants or NSAIDs. The risk is dose-dependent for both medications, with higher aspirin doses (>100mg daily) conferring greater risk.

Management and Precautions

When aspirin and dabigatran must be used together, careful risk-benefit assessment is essential. Consider using the lowest effective aspirin dose (typically 75-100mg daily) and monitor patients closely for bleeding signs. Regular assessment of renal function is crucial as dabigatran clearance depends on kidney function. Patients should be educated about bleeding symptoms and advised to seek immediate medical attention for unusual bruising, prolonged bleeding, black stools, or severe headaches. Consider proton pump inhibitor therapy for gastrointestinal protection. Regular monitoring of hemoglobin levels and clinical bleeding assessments are recommended. In patients with high bleeding risk, alternative anticoagulation strategies or cardioprotective approaches should be considered.

Aspirin interactions with food and lifestyle

Alcohol: Concurrent use of aspirin with alcohol increases the risk of gastrointestinal bleeding and stomach ulcers. Patients should limit or avoid alcohol consumption while taking aspirin, especially with regular use or higher doses. This interaction is well-documented in clinical guidelines and drug databases due to the combined irritant effects on the gastric mucosa and increased bleeding risk.

Dabigatran interactions with food and lifestyle

Dabigatran should be taken with food to reduce gastrointestinal side effects and improve tolerability. Alcohol consumption should be limited or avoided while taking dabigatran, as alcohol may increase the risk of bleeding complications. Patients should avoid activities with high risk of injury or trauma due to the increased bleeding risk associated with dabigatran therapy.
